Kevin Hart's Wife Eniko Speaks On His Cheating Scandal In New Netflix Documentary

In the trailer for his six-part documentary 'Kevin Hart: Don’t F**k This Up,' the wife of the superstar comedian admits to feeling "publically humiliated." 
Kevin Hart’s Netflix Documentary ‘Don’t F**k This Up’ Addresses Cheating Scandal
By Jasmine Grant · Updated November 4, 2020

To say that Kevin Hart has experienced a controversial few years would be an understatement. The Philadelphia native has been the subject of headlines over his past homophobic tweets, cheating scandals and the list goes on. Before 2019 comes to a close, the comedian plans to take a sobering look at his past choices – especially within his marriage to wife Eniko Hart.

In the 2-minute trailer for his new Netflix documentary Kevin Hart: Don’t F**k This Up, the Jumanji star gives his fans a raw look at his life behind the scenes. “Before people judge and say Kevin Hart is a dickhead and an asshole, I want you to understand that there’s a lot you don’t know,” he says in the opening scene.

Halfway through the teaser, an emotionally distressed Eniko (who was pregnant at the time of her husband’s cheating scandal) is heard confronting Kevin about his betrayal. “You publicly humiliated me,” says her voice over. “I just kept saying ‘How the f*** did you let that happen?'”

Article continues after video.

Back in October 2017, the comedian decided to come clean to his fans about an alleged extortion attempt that included a “sexually provocative” video of him with another woman. Hart apologized to a then-8-months pregnant Eniko as he admitted that someone was using the tapes and images to allegedly extort money from him.

“I’m guilty, regardless of how it happened and what was involved, the s–t that I can’t talk about, I’m guilty. I’m wrong,” he later told The Breakfast Club, adding that he was angered by people suggesting his cheating was Eniko’s karma for. “That title was put on her by my ex out of anger.”

It seems Hart plans to put it all on the table with this honest look at his personal life. The documentary is set to premiere on Dec. 27. Will you be watching?
